One of the most important aspects of retirement advice in Dublin is financial planning. The cost of living in the capital is higher than in many other parts of Ireland, making it essential to build a strong financial foundation. Advisors often recommend starting early with pension contributions, whether through employer-sponsored plans or personal retirement savings accounts. Compounding interest and tax benefits make early contributions particularly valuable. For those closer to retirement, maximizing contributions and exploring investment options such as diversified portfolios, property, or annuities can help ensure a steady income stream. Dublin’s financial services sector offers a wide range of resources, and professional advisors can tailor strategies to individual circumstances.

Healthcare planning is another critical element of retirement advice in Dublin. As people age, medical needs typically increase, and having a plan for healthcare expenses is vital. While Ireland provides public healthcare, many retirees choose supplemental private insurance to cover additional services and reduce waiting times. Advisors encourage individuals to factor healthcare costs into their retirement budgets, ensuring that they can access quality care when needed. Preventive health measures, such as regular checkups, exercise, and balanced nutrition, are also emphasized, as they contribute to a longer, healthier retirement.

Housing considerations are also part of retirement planning in Dublin. Some retirees choose to downsize, moving from larger family homes to smaller, more manageable properties. Others may explore retirement communities or assisted living options. Advisors help individuals weigh the financial and lifestyle implications of these choices, ensuring that housing decisions align with long-term goals. Property values in Dublin can be high, so careful planning is necessary to make the most of housing assets.

Tax planning is another area where retirement advice proves invaluable. Understanding how pensions, investments, and other income sources are taxed in Ireland helps retirees maximize their resources. Advisors can identify strategies to reduce tax burdens, such as timing withdrawals or utilizing tax-efficient investment vehicles. This ensures that retirees keep more of their hard-earned savings and enjoy greater financial freedom.
